Flying from Dallas to Harrisburg International Airport (MDT): What you need to know
Your adventure begins at one of Dallas's main airports, Dallas/Fort Worth International Airport (DFW) or Dallas Love Field Airport (DAL). Explore your options for booking a flight from Dallas to Harrisburg International Airport (MDT) taking off from either of these.
Around 3 hours is how long you can expect to be traveling on a direct Dallas to Harrisburg International Airport flight.
The timezone in Harrisburg is UTC-4, which is one hour ahead of Dallas. Harrisburg International Airport is located in Harrisburg.
Choose from 7 direct flights a week between Dallas/Fort Worth International Airport (DFW) and Harrisburg International Airport (MDT). This is the most popular route, with American Airlines offering a 6:30pm departure from DFW to MDT.

Dallas Love Field Airport (DAL)
DAL is about 10 miles from central Dallas. It'll take you 20 minutes or so to get to the airport if you're driving from the city center. Public transport takes approximately 50 minutes.

The best time to fly from Dallas to Harrisburg International Airport (MDT)
July is the most popular month for flights from Dallas to Harrisburg International Airport (MDT). Visit Harrisburg in February for a more low-key escape.
Book a Dallas to MDT plane ticket departing in July if you're eager to explore the city during its warmest month. Expect temperatures in Harrisburg to range from 61ºF to 88ºF.
January has temperatures of between 16ºF and 45ºF. Look for cheap tickets from Dallas to Harrisburg International Airport around that time if you like traveling in cooler conditions.
